Text
(A)"Applicant" means an individual whose written application for Medicaid has been submitted to the agency determining Medicaid eligibility, but has not received final action. This includes an individual, living or deceased, whose application is submitted by a representative or a person acting responsibly for the individual.
(B)"Department" means the South Carolina Department of Health and Human Services.
(C)"Medicaid" means the medical assistance program authorized by Title XIX of the Social Security Act and administered by the department.
(D)"Person" means a natural person, company, association, partnership, corporation, or other legal entity.
(E)"Practitioner" means a physician or other health care professional licensed under state law to practice his profession.
